Default femoral nerve neuropathy

I had a very long back fusion on April6th 2008, the surgery lasted 12 hours, when i woke up my left leg was in severe pain, after about a month of excruciating pain my surgeon referred me to a neurologist to have a EMG, it came back posiyive for femoral nerve damage, that was 3 years ago, my leg is in excruciating pain and I have had 2 more back surgeries since then , one in 2009 and another fusion in 2010, i have seen many doctors and surgeons and my leg is getting worse , not better, my left knee is in excruciating pain, i am on Percocet 10-650, Lyrica, Soma, Xanax, and many other drugs. Before my first surgery I was not taking any of these drugs. I aused to work for General Motors and now I am on total disability. My leg is getting worse and I just saw a knee specialist who told me nothing can be done except pain management drugs. If anyone out there has any answers for me or knows of any hospital or doctors who can help me, please let me know because I am gradually losing the use of my leg. Thank you for any help anyone can suggest
